from player import Player
from snake import Snake
from ladder import Ladder
from dice import Dice
from board import Board
from level import Level
class Game:
def __init__(self) -> None:
self.players = []
self.dice = Dice(6)
# let players select a level
self.level = Level()
self.select_level()
# set up board
self.board = Board(self.level.get_board_size())
self.create_board()
def select_level(self):
level1 = Level('Easy', 30)
level2 = Level('Medium', 50)
level3 = Level('Hard', 100)
selected_level = input('select level: Easy/Medium/Hard: ')
if selected_level == 'Easy':
self.level = level1
elif selected_level == 'Medium':
self.level = level2
else:
self.level = level3
def create_board(self):
ladders = {3: 22, 5: 8, 11: 26, 20: 29}
snakes = {17: 4, 19: 7, 21: 9, 27: 1}
for x, y in ladders.items():
self.board.place_ladder(Ladder(x, y))
for x, y in snakes.items():
self.board.place_snake(Snake(x, y))
def add_players(self):
print("Add Players for a New Game")
player_count = int(input("Enter Number of Players: "))
for num in range(player_count):
username = input(f"Enter name Player#{num + 1}: ")
player_obj = Player(username)
self.players.append(player_obj)
def show_players(self):
print(f'{len(self.players)} Players:')
for player in self.players:
print(player.username)
def start_game(self):
CONTINUE = True
print("Starting Game...")
round_number = 0
while CONTINUE:
round_number += 1
print(f'====================< {round_number} >========================')
for player in self.players:
print(f'-> {player.username} turn')
input("throw dice -- <press Enter>")
#Generate Random Number b/w 1 and 6
dice = self.dice.get_value()
print(f' You got {dice}')
six_count = 0
sum = dice
while dice == 6:
input(f' Got {dice}, throw again -- <press Enter>')
dice = self.dice.get_value()
print(f' You got {dice}')
six_count += 1
sum += dice
if six_count == 2:
print(" WOW!! Consecutive 3 times 'Six'")
break
pos = player.position + sum
if self.board.is_snake_present(pos):
print(" Hiss!! snake bites")
dest = self.board.get_snake_tail(pos)
print(f' you fall down to {dest}')
player.position = dest
elif self.board.is_ladder_present(pos):
print(" Great!! You found a ladder")
dest = self.board.get_ladder_dest(pos)
print(f' you climb to {dest}')
player.position = dest
else:
dest = pos
print(f' your Latest Position is {dest}')
player.position = dest
if dest >= self.board.size:
print(f' Hurray!! {player.username} win.')
CONTINUE = False
break
